    Abstract: A method of pumping DEF (diesel exhaust fluid) in a diesel emissions control system. The method includes pumping DEF from an auxiliary DEF tank to an onboard DEF tank. The DEF is pumped from the auxiliary DEF tank to the onboard DEF tank. The fluid pathway is purged with air after pumping the DEF from the auxiliary DEF tank to the onboard DEF tank. The air is pumped (1) through the fluid pathway from the auxiliary DEF tank, or (2) into the auxiliary DEF tank.
